Which country is the father of physics?

Galileo Galilei, an Italian mathematician, astronomer, and physicist, was dubbed the Father of Physics for his significant contribution to determining the motion of things and developing the telescope. He used his telescope to detect the phases of Venus as well as the four biggest moons of Jupiter.

Is physics research useful?

Solar cells, computers, wireless technologies, and diagnostic imaging are all rooted in breakthroughs made by theoretical physicists. The reason is simple: technology relies on the laws of nature, so a better understanding of those laws allows us to create more powerful technologies.

What are the field of research in physics?

Nanotechnology: the science of building circuits and machines from single molecules and atoms. Nuclear Physics: The study of the physical properties of the atomic nucleus. Particle Physics: The study of fundamental particles and the forces of their interaction. Plasma Physics: The study of matter in the plasma phase.
